Oncology
Our Oncology Services are managed by the Internal Medicine team
headed by Rob Foale, assisted by Simon
Tappin and Jon Wray
Our comprehensive, multidisciplinary oncology service
encompasses all aspects of modern cancer medicine, from the initial
assessment, clinical disease staging (via, for example,
comprehensive diagnostic imaging, cytology and bone marrow
evaluation) and paraneoplastic complication consideration through
to chemotherapy and/or comprehensive surgery, including
intra-cavitary cytotoxic therapy administration where appropriate.
When required, arrangements can be made for external beam radiation
therapy.
In addition to our clinical work, we have several on-going
scientific investigations in the field of small animal oncology,
thereby endeavouring to advance our knowledge and bring further
benefits to patients in the future.
We also run an out-patient Oncology Clinic for regular
chemotherapy appointments, run by the Specialists and dedicated
medical nurses and we are very happy to work in conjunction with
referring veterinarians to help decide upon and administer
appropriate chemotherapeutic regimes. We also always offer to make
ourselves available to the clients and the referring veterinary
surgeons at any point after the patient has been discharged should
further advice or guidance be sought.
